Frequently Asked Questions - AT-VGW-250 Atlona

How do I set up the Atlona AT-VGW-250 NAS for the first time?
Connect the NAS to your network using the Ethernet cable, then plug in the power adapter. Install the drives, power on the device, and use the mobile app or web browser to access the admin interface. Follow the setup wizard to configure network settings and create volumes.
What RAID level should I choose for maximum data safety?
For maximum data protection, choose RAID 1 (mirroring). It duplicates your data across two drives, so if one drive fails, your data remains safe. The usable capacity is halved, but the reliability is worth it for important files.
Can I access my files from anywhere using the AT-VGW-250?
Yes, the NAS supports remote access via a secure cloud service or by configuring port forwarding on your router. You can then connect using the mobile app or web interface from any internet-connected device.
How can I stream videos and music stored on the NAS to my TV?
The NAS includes a media server feature that makes your video, photo, and music libraries available on your local network. Use DLNA-compatible TVs or media players, or use the built-in apps for smart TVs to browse and stream content directly.
Is there any risk of data loss during a power outage?
The NAS supports file system journaling (ext4 or Btrfs) to protect against corruption from unexpected power loss. For additional safety, connect the NAS to a UPS (uninterruptible power supply) to allow a clean shutdown and avoid damage to sensitive components.
How do I connect the AT-VGW-250 to my existing home router?
Simply connect one end of the included Ethernet cable to any LAN port on your router and the other end to a Gigabit Ethernet port on the NAS. The NAS will automatically receive an IP address via DHCP, and you can find it using the discovery utility or the vendor's mobile app.
Can I replace a failed hard drive without losing my data?
If you are using RAID 1, yes. Power off the NAS, remove the failed drive, insert a new one of equal or larger capacity, then power on. The NAS will automatically rebuild the mirror. If you use JBOD or RAID 0, a failed drive causes data loss, so always keep a separate backup.
What is the best way to back up my computer to the NAS?
Install the provided backup software on your PC or Mac, or use built-in tools like Windows File History or macOS Time Machine. Configure the NAS as the backup destination and set a schedule for automatic backups to keep your files safe.
What can I use the USB ports on the AT-VGW-250 for?
The USB ports allow you to connect external storage (like USB drives) for additional capacity or direct access to files. You can also connect a USB printer and turn the NAS into a print server, or use a UPS for safe shutdown.
How many drives and total capacity does the AT-VGW-250 support?
The NAS has 2 drive bays and supports 2.5-inch or 3.5-inch SATA drives. With modern 20 TB drives, you can reach a maximum internal storage of 40 TB (or 20 TB with RAID 1).
